Understanding the Price of Car Hand Brake Cables


Car maintenance often involves a wide variety of parts, but among these, the hand brake cable is crucial for ensuring safety and functionality. As a vital component of the vehicle's braking system, the hand brake cable allows drivers to engage the parking brake (also known as the handbrake) effectively. Over time, wear and tear can compromise its performance, leading to the need for replacement. This article will explore the factors affecting the price of car hand brake cables, what to consider when purchasing, and some general price ranges.


Factors Influencing the Price


1. Type of Vehicle The price of a hand brake cable can vary significantly depending on the make and model of the vehicle. For instance, specialized or luxury vehicles might require tailored components, driving the price higher. Conversely, more common vehicles may have more readily available and thus cheaper options.


2. Material Quality Hand brake cables are typically made of steel or other durable materials. Higher-quality cables, which may include features such as rust resistance or enhanced flexibility, tend to cost more. When searching for a replacement, investing in a good-quality cable can increase longevity and overall performance.


3. Brand Reputation Well-known automotive brands often charge more for their parts due to established reliability and trustworthiness. Off-brand or generic options are usually available at a lower price point but may come with concerns about their longevity or performance.


4. Retail Environment The price can also vary based on where you buy the cable. Online retailers may offer competitive prices due to lower overhead costs compared to local auto parts stores. However, local shops might provide the advantage of immediate availability and personalized customer service.


5. Professional vs. DIY Installation If you plan to install the cable yourself, consider the potential cost savings. However, if you opt for professional installation, labor costs will add to the expense. Always get a quote from a mechanic before proceeding to understand the total costs involved.

General Price Ranges


While prices for hand brake cables can differ widely based on the above factors, a typical range can be found. Most basic hand brake cables can cost between $15 to $50. For specific models, particularly newer or specialized vehicles, the prices may increase to $100 or more. Including labor costs, total expenses (cable plus installation) could range anywhere from $100 to $300, depending on the vehicle.


Tips for Purchasing


- Research Before making a purchase, research the specific requirements for your vehicle's make and model. Consult your owner’s manual or online forums to understand what to look for. - Read Reviews Check customer reviews and ratings of various brands and models. This can provide valuable insights into their reliability and performance.


- Comparison Shop Take time to compare prices from different retailers both online and locally. This allows you to balance cost with quality effectively.


- Ask About Warranties Inquire if the product comes with a warranty. A longer warranty often indicates greater confidence in the product’s durability.
